Filters
Out of stock
Color
Size
Coverage
Price
CHF
CHF
Sleeve length type
Color
Sort by
Charm Surf Bikini Top
CHF 59.90
hey leo
Main Design
aquamarine
Main Design
emerald
Main Design
amethyst
Main Design
coconut stripes
Main Design
dark coral
Main Design
seabreeze mint
Main Design
black
Main Design
stormy tie dye purple
Main Design
+ 6 more
XS S M L XL

22 reviews
Pasta Bikini Top
CHF 59.90
pink diamond
Main Design
stormy tie dye black
Main Design
ocean
Main Design
black
Main Design
+ 1 more
XS S M L XL

8 reviews
Sassy Bikini Top
CHF 59.90
black
Main Design
seabreeze mint
Main Design
stormy tie dye purple
Main Design
ocean
Main Design
black sand
Main Design
elderberry
Main Design
+ 3 more
XS S M L XL

14 reviews
Sassy bikini top reversible
CHF 59.90
aquamarine/amethyst
Main Design
coconut stripes/white
Main Design
emerald/hey leo
Main Design
pink diamond/jade
Main Design
cali sunglow/wild lavender
Main Design
apricot sunset/sea spray
Main Design
+ 3 more
XS S M L XL

4 reviews
Blush Surf Bikini Bottom
CHF 59.90
ocean
Main Design
amethyst
Main Design
coconut stripes
Main Design
pink diamond
Main Design
seabreeze mint
Main Design
black
Main Design
dark coral
Main Design
stormy tie dye purple
Main Design
elderberry
Main Design
+ 6 more
XS S M L XL

12 reviews
Keira Surf Bikini Bottom
CHF 54.90
black
Main Design
ocean
Main Design
stormy tie dye black
Main Design
XS S M L XL

1 review
Serene Surf Bikini Bottoms
CHF 59.90
hey leo
Main Design
aquamarine
Main Design
black
Main Design
emerald
Main Design
ocean
Main Design
stormy tie dye black
Main Design
+ 3 more
XS S M L XL

2 reviews
Lush UV Surf Shirt
CHF 54.90
hey leo
Main Design
coconut stripes
Main Design
S/M M/L

1 review
Divine Surf Suit
CHF 99.90
black/amethyst
Main Design
black/seabreeze mint
Main Design
amethyst
Main Design
elderberry
Main Design
deep sea
Main Design
stormy tie dye purple
Main Design
caramel/salty leo
Main Design
+ 4 more
XS S M L XL

6 reviews
Ivy Surf Suit
CHF 119.90
deep sea
Main Design
black/sailor blue
Main Design
elderberry
Main Design
XS S M L XL

1 review
Nova swimsuit
CHF 99.90
amethyst
Main Design
hey leo
Main Design
pink diamond
Main Design
coconut stripes
Main Design
+ 1 more
S M L

2 reviews
Maria Rashguard
CHF 69.90
black
Main Design
elderberry
Main Design
stormy tie dye black
Main Design
S M L
Lush UV surf shirt
CHF 34.90 CHF 54.90
Sale
stormy tie dye purple
Main Design
S M L

1 review
Flare Surf Bikini Top
CHF 19.95 CHF 59.90
Sale
black/salty leo
Main Design
XS S M L XL

3 reviews
Blush Surf Bikini Bottom
CHF 19.95 CHF 54.90
Sale
caramel
Main Design
salty leo
Main Design
XS S M L XL

2 reviews
Kimono Amazon
CHF 69.90
Terracotta
Main Design
Olive Grey
Main Design